Obverse description A warship at sea in the central field, set against a mountainous landscape with a radiant rising sun in the background. The legend REPUBLICA ARGENTINA arcs along the upper rim, with the date 1898 positioned to the right in the field.
Obverse script Log in to see details
Obverse lettering Log in to see details
Reverse description The Argentine national coat of arms — an oval cartouche depicting a handshake beneath a Phrygian cap on a pike, surmounted by a radiant rising sun — encircled by a laurel wreath tied at the base with a ribbon. The circular legend reads LA PATRIA Y SUS SUSCRITORES across the upper field and PRO-PATRIA DOLORES (B. AIRES) along the lower, with the maker's name ORZALI B. Y C. inscribed in small letters at the base of the central device.
